Fat Man Unleashed’s resident doctor, Dr. Kal, was recently featured on CNN’s Fit Nation with Dr. Sanjay Gupta. The minute I heard about it I was excited, not only was Dr. Kal given some love for his hard work and success, but now he can help share that expertise with even more people that could benefit.

Dr. Kalvin Chinyere has been contributing his health, weight loss, and fitness knowledge to FMU for quite some time now.

Dr. Kal is a physician, weight-loss expert and ex-fat man. He is also the creator of the Don’t Go Broke Weight Loss Plan and maintains his own health blog at Dr. Kal’s Blog. He is living proof that his program works. What more proof do you need?

The CNN piece covers how Dr. Kal saw patients die from obesity related diseases and changed his life. CNN’s Dr. Sanjay Gupta reports on his success.
